Archbishops of Dublin, Canterbury and Armagh: the Most Revd Dr John Neill, the Most Revd Dr Rowan Williams and the Most Revd Dr Robin Eames, processing with chaplains to the General Synod service in St Patrick's cathedral, Armagh on Tuesday 11 May 2004 marking the introduction of the new Book of Common Prayer 2004.
